What is opal? Origin and characteristics

The opal is a precious stone composed of hydrated silica, known for its changing reflections called opalescence. Its amorphous structure, different from traditional crystals, gives it a unique shine, highly sought after in jewelry.

We distinguish several types of opals : white, pink, green, black, fiery or dendritic. Each variety is distinguished by its colors, its properties in lithotherapy and its uses in jewelry, like the ring in opal, the bracelet opal or the necklace in opal.

As for the origin, the most famous deposits are found in Australia, Ethiopia, and Mexico. price of an opal depends on its rarity, its brilliance, and the vividness of its colors.

Symbolic Meaning of Opal Through the Ages

Since Antiquity, opal has been shrouded in mystery. The Romans saw it as a symbol of love and hope. In the Middle Ages, it was considered a stone of luck and clairvoyance. Although some periods gave it a reputation as a stone of misfortune, it is now recognized in crystal healing for its ability to enhance intuition and inner balance.

Each color carries a specific meaning:

  • White opal: clarity of mind, serenity

  • Pink opal: sincere love, emotional gentleness

  • Green opal: balance, inner growth

Overall, opal is associated with creativity, transformation, and emotional protection, making it a deeply symbolic and personal gift.

Opal in Jewelry: A Gem as Precious as It Is Delicate

Used for centuries in fine jewelry, opal has become a highly sought-after stone in contemporary creations. Whether it's for an opal ring, opal necklace, opal bracelet, or even a genuine opal pendant, it captivates with its shimmering reflections and powerful symbolism.

Why choose opal jewelry?

  • Each opal stone is unique: its colors, internal patterns, and play of light are never identical.

  • It pairs beautifully with white gold, rose gold, or silver—especially in personalized designs.

  • Opal rings, particularly women’s opal rings, are often gifted as symbols of love, commitment, or to mark special occasions.

A delicate gemstone that requires careful handling

  • On the Mohs scale of hardness, opal ranges between 5.5 and 6.5, making it more prone to scratches and impacts than harder stones like sapphire or diamond

  • Opal naturally contains water (up to 20%), making it sensitive to heat, excessive humidity, and sudden temperature changes.

  • It’s best to avoid contact with chemicals, perfumes, or solvents, as these can dull its shine.

To protect your women’s opal ring or opal bracelet, store it separately in a soft-lined box. And to preserve the beauty of your opal stone, avoid wearing it during intense physical activities.

How to clean and recharge opal ?

Opal is a delicate precious stone, which requires a adapted maintenance to maintain all its shine. Its porous structure and water content make it sensitive to external aggressions.

How to clean an opal jewelry ?

  • Use a soft cloth (like microfiber) slightly dampened with warm water.
  • Absolutely avoid chemical cleaners, ultrasonic or aggressive jewelry baths.
  • Do not rub vigorously: this could dull the natural shine. opal stone.

For a opal bracelet or a opal ring for women Very dirty, it is recommended to entrust the cleaning to a professional.
